Price Ranges: Luxury vs. Designer vs. Premium

The world of high-priced footwear can be divided into several categories:

  • Luxury: Often handcrafted, limited in quantity, and priced from $1,000 to over $100,000.
  • Designer: Produced by well-known fashion houses, typically ranging from $500 to $2,000.
  • Premium: High-quality materials and construction, but not always branded, usually $200 to $500.

Each segment offers its own blend of exclusivity, craftsmanship, and aesthetic appeal.

Artisan and Bespoke Shoemakers

Traditional shoemakers like John Lobb, Edward Green, and George Cleverley focus on bespoke and made-to-order shoes. These artisans use time-honored techniques, offering unparalleled fit and finish. Bespoke shoes can require dozens of hours to craft and may cost several thousand dollars, reflecting the expertise involved.

Leather Types and Quality

Premium shoes typically use top-grade full-grain or calfskin leather. These materials are supple to the touch, develop a beautiful patina with age, and offer breathability that enhances comfort. Inferior leathers, by contrast, often feel stiff and may deteriorate rapidly.

Exotic Materials: Alligator, Ostrich, and More

Some luxury shoes incorporate exotic skins such as alligator, ostrich, or python. These materials provide unique textures and visual appeal, but they also require specialized skills to work with. The rarity and difficulty of sourcing these leathers contribute significantly to the cost.

Durability: Do Expensive Shoes Last Longer?

Longevity is a key argument in favor of investing in high-priced shoes. The question remains: do they actually outlast their less expensive counterparts?

Construction Techniques That Enhance Longevity

Techniques such as Goodyear welting and Blake stitching allow shoes to be resoled multiple times, extending their lifespan. Reinforced stitching, high-quality adhesives, and robust shanks contribute to structural integrity.

Sole Quality and Replacement Options

Luxury brands often use leather or high-grade rubber soles that offer both comfort and durability. Many also provide resoling services, allowing customers to refresh their shoes rather than replace them entirely.

How to Maintain Expensive Shoes for Maximum Lifespan

Proper care is essential for preserving the value of expensive footwear. This includes regular cleaning, conditioning, and storage in cool, dry conditions. Investing in shoe trees and dust bags can further protect against creases and moisture damage.

Cost Per Wear: Breaking Down the Math

One useful metric is the “cost per wear,” which divides the purchase price by the number of times the shoes are worn. A $1,000 pair that lasts for years and remains a wardrobe staple may ultimately prove more economical than several cheap pairs that quickly wear out.

Caring for Your Investment: Shoe Maintenance Tips

Proper maintenance is essential for preserving the appearance and longevity of expensive shoes.

Proper Storage Techniques

Store shoes in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Use shoe trees to maintain shape and minimize creasing, and keep dust bags handy for travel or long-term storage.

Cleaning and Conditioning High-End Materials

Use pH-balanced cleaners and conditioners suitable for the specific material—be it leather, suede, or exotic skins. Gentle brushing and regular conditioning prevent drying and cracking.

When to Seek Professional Shoe Care

For complex repairs or deep cleaning, consult a professional cobbler experienced in luxury footwear. They can restore soles, replace linings, and address stains without compromising the shoe’s integrity.
